Bangladesh have rarely been considered favourites when facing the top nations in world cricket. Yet on several occasions, they have produced results that left the cricketing world stunned.

From a famous World Cup group-stage win in 1999 to a historic Test victory in challenging conditions in 2022, Bangladesh have shown they are capable of rising to the occasion against the biggest sides in world cricket.

They are in the driver's seat in the ongoing first Test against Australia at the Marrara Cricket Ground in Darwin. It is a fitting moment for cricket aficionados to look back at some of the watershed moments in Bangladesh's cricket annals.

3 moments when Bangladesh caused upsets against giant nations

3. Bangladesh beat Pakistan, 1999 ODI World Cup

Bangladesh entered the 1999 Cricket World Cup having qualified by winning the 1997 ICC Trophy (now known as the ICC World Cup Qualifier) in Malaysia. Few expected them to trouble Pakistan, a side that included Wasim Akram, Saeed Anwar and Shoaib Akhtar. Bangladesh defeated Pakistan by 62 runs in what is widely regarded as one of the greatest shocks in World Cup history. The result had a lasting impact beyond the match itself. Bangladesh's performances at the 1999 tournament, which also included a win over Scotland, helped accelerate their promotion to Full Member status in international cricket. The iconic victory against the Men in Green came at the County Ground in Northampton.

 

2. Bangladesh beat India, 2007 ODI World Cup

On March 17, 2007, Bangladesh met India for the first time at a Cricket World Cup, in Group B at Queen's Park Oval in Port of Spain, Trinidad and Tobago. Bangladesh won by 5 wickets with 9 balls remaining, defeating a side captained by Rahul Dravid. India subsequently lost to Sri Lanka and exited the tournament without advancing to the Super Eights. Bangladesh, by contrast, qualified from the group stage for the first time, advancing to the Super Eights. The result is cited among the greatest upsets in World Cup history and is credited with prompting a restructuring of future World Cup formats to ensure longer participation from major sides.

1. Bangladesh beat New Zealand, 1st Test, Bay Oval, 2022

In 2022, Bangladesh travelled to New Zealand and defeated the then-reigning World Test Champions in the first Test at Bay Oval, Mount Maunganui. The result marked a significant moment in Bangladesh's Test history, as wins in New Zealand are rare for touring sides. The victory demonstrated that Bangladesh's Test cricket had developed to a level where they could compete and win away from home against established Test nations. The Kiwis were on a 17-match home unbeaten streak in Test cricket in the lead-up to this game, making the victory even more monumental.
